I was delighted to hear the great news that Mantles, a collaborative project between myself and artist Margo McNulty has been awarded a Government of Ireland Creative Ireland Bursary and funding – with gratitude! – from Kildare County Council and Roscommon County Council.

Photograph by Margo McNulty (c) 2021 – Close up of green oak leaves
Mantles explores the themes of heritage and sense of place symbolising Brigid. Through archival artefacts and site visits it aims to create through words and images new representations of Brigid as an archetype of the sacred feminine. We will update our progress on the project page Mantles.
